Add support for building on ChromeOS
authorAlexis Hetu <sugoi@google.com>
Tue, 25 Jan 2022 15:10:27 +0000 (10:10 -0500)
committerCharles Giessen <46324611+charles-lunarg@users.noreply.github.com>
Wed, 26 Jan 2022 16:34:38 +0000 (09:34 -0700)
BUILD.gn

index a6b6552..deb5ce3 100644 (file)
--- a/BUILD.gn
+++ b/BUILD.gn
@@ -37,7 +37,7 @@ config("vulkan_internal_config") {
   if (is_clang || !is_win) {
     cflags = [ "-Wno-unused-function" ]
   }
-  if (is_linux) {
+  if (is_linux || is_chromeos) {
     defines += [
       "SYSCONFDIR=\"/etc\"",
       "FALLBACK_CONFIG_DIRS=\"/etc/xdg\"",
@@ -74,7 +74,7 @@ if (!is_android) {
       sources += [ "icd/windows/VkICD_mock_icd.json" ]
       args += [ "$raw_vulkan_icd_dir/windows" ]
     }
-    if (is_linux) {
+    if (is_linux || is_chromeos) {
       sources += [ "icd/linux/VkICD_mock_icd.json" ]
       args += [ "$raw_vulkan_icd_dir/linux" ]
     }